Output 10943aac4596ae1d656842160cbb4eaf56a6abb690c7a167ad8dbe1d9d3d92ad:0

value
996521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1102eb20a7a6ae7a14895e7315d9cddb0c89c898 OP_EQUAL
address
33ExuaoCP76bpufKQwdwU15b6oyFKNQfhk
transaction
10943aac4596ae1d656842160cbb4eaf56a6abb690c7a167ad8dbe1d9d3d92ad
spent
true